WebThe spouse of a Singaporean citizen with at least two years of permanent residency and married for a minimum of two years before the date of application can apply for Singapore citizenship by marriage. WebTo become a Canadian citizen, you must be a permanent resident have lived in Canada for 3 out of the last 5 years have filed your taxes, if you need to pass a test on your rights, responsibilities and knowledge of Canada prove your language skills Depending on your situation, there may be additional requirements.
